Kentavious Caldwell-Pope is one of two familiar faces that Andre Drummond found when he joined the Los Angeles Lakers. The other one was Markieff Morris.

Drummond and Caldwell-Pope were teammates on the Detroit Pistons through 2013-2017. After the loss to the Miami Heat in which KCP led his team in scoring with 28 points, the Lakers center was asked about the development of his teammate over the years.

“Having that relationship with KCP and seeing how he is now from where he was when he got drafted in Detroit is night and day,” Drummond said.

“Defensively he’s still and incredible defender shooting-wise he’s gotten so much better and just his confidence off the dribble has been incredible for us. Tonight was a great game for him. Just sucks that we didn’t win the game.”
